Analysis

The most recent figure for percentage of teachers in primary education who are female in Suriname is 95.5%, measured in 2021. That is the highest value across all 37 years on record.

That represents a change of up 0.2% on the previous year and up 2.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, percentage of teachers in primary education who are female in Suriname peaked at 95.5% in 2021 and was at its lowest, 61.0%, in 1972.

Suriname ranks 12th of 212 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 37 years of available data.

Percentage of teachers in primary education who are female in Suriname, year by year

Annual values for Percentage of teachers in primary education who are female (%) in Suriname, 1971 to 2021.
Year % Change
1971 62.0%
1972 61.0% -1.6%
1973 63.0% +3.3%
1974 68.5% +8.7%
1975 64.0% -6.5%
1976 65.0% +1.6%
1977 66.7% +2.6%
1978 74.9% +12.3%
1979 76.3% +1.9%
1982 78.8% +3.2%
1986 83.0% +5.3%
1987 85.4% +2.9%
1988 85.6% +0.2%
1989 82.9% -3.2%
1990 83.0% +0.1%
1991 84.1% +1.3%
1992 86.5% +2.9%
1993 87.2% +0.8%
2001 82.3% -5.7%
2002 85.1% +3.4%
2005 92.0% +8.2%
2006 90.9% -1.2%
2007 91.9% +1.1%
2008 93.1% +1.2%
2009 93.2% +0.1%
2010 93.2% +0.1%
2011 93.5% +0.3%
2012 93.9% +0.5%
2013 94.2% +0.3%
2014 94.5% +0.3%
2015 94.5% +0.0%
2016 94.8% +0.4%
2017 95.3% +0.4%
2018 95.1% -0.1%
2019 95.1% +0.0%
2020 95.3% +0.2%
2021 95.5% +0.2%

Suriname compared with similar countries

  • Suriname's 95.5% is above the median for upper middle income countries, which is 79.4%, 1.2× the median. (57 countries reporting)
  • Suriname's 95.5% is above the median for Latin America & Caribbean, which is 81.2%, 1.2× the median. (38 countries reporting)
